S2NHA M Sport/ZTR brake code

I'm casually shopping for an 2018 or 2019 F30 340i XDrive, and have begun to notice the above brake package - Brembo blue calipers - are only available on cars with 19" wheels. I then presume that 18" wheels will not fit over said M Sport calipers.
Can anyone confirm?

M-sport brakes with 370mm rotors fit 18" wheels just fine.

400m, 405m, 513m, Apex SM-10, and BW TA5R are just a few 18" I've run with them.
